随着数字经济的发展,加密货币已成为财富管理和投资的新宠。但是,伴随而来的是对于加密货币安全性的深切关注。尤其是当涉及到解锁机制时,如何保障用户的资产不受损失,成为了一个备受瞩目的话题。本文将深入探讨加密货币的解锁机制,如何保障用户权益以及其在实际应用中的重要性与挑战。
什么是加密货币解锁机制?
加密货币解锁机制是指在区块链网络中,用户如何能够访问和管理其持有的数字资产的过程。这种机制通常与私钥和公钥的生成、储存及使用密切相关。用户通过私钥进行交易,而公钥则用于接收资金。解锁机制确保只有合法持有者才能访问和控制他们的加密货币,同时也减少了被盗用的风险。
解锁机制的核心在于加密学,尤其是非对称加密。用户生成一对密钥:私钥与公钥。公钥相对公开,任何人可以通过它向用户发送加密货币;而私钥则必须严格保密,因为任何掌握私钥的人都可以对资产进行访问和操作。解锁机制的设计目的是为了在确保用户便捷使用资产的同时,尽可能地降低安全隐患。
解锁机制的类型及其应用

不同的加密货币可能会有不同的解锁机制,主要分为几种类型:
1. **单一私钥机制**:这是最常见的解锁方式,用户只能通过私钥解锁他们的钱包。例如,比特币(BTC)和以太坊(ETH)使用的就是这种机制。用户在创建钱包时会生成一对密钥,钱包的访问完全依赖于私钥的安全性。
2. **多重签名机制**:多重签名钱包需要多个密钥进行授权才能执行交易,这样即使一个密钥被盗,攻击者也无法单独操作资金。比如,一些企业或机构会使用多重签名来增加安全性,以防止内部人员或外部攻击。
3. **时间锁机制**:时间锁实际上是将资金锁定在合约中,在特定时间段内无法解锁。这种机制通常用于投机或者长期投资,确保资产在某段时间内无法被随意使用。
4. **智能合约**:智能合约可以称得上是区块链中的一项革命性应用。通过智能合约,用户可以设置条件,只有当满足了这些条件时,才能解锁资金。例如,在某些去中心化金融(DeFi)平台上,用户可能需要满足特定的交易条件才能解锁他们的资产。
解锁机制的安全性分析
尽管加密货币的解锁机制在理论上能够提供安全保障,但在实际应用中却并非铁板一块。以下是一些可能存在的安全隐患:
1. **私钥泄露**:用户将私钥保存在不安全的地方(例如云端或其他公共平台)或未能及时更新安全策略,可能导致私钥被恶意软件盗用,从而损失资产。
2. **社工攻击**:不法分子可能会通过社交工程手段,诱骗用户透露其私钥或有关信息。例如,通过伪装成客服人员进行身份验证,进而获取敏感信息。
3. **智能合约漏洞**:智能合约本身也可能存在漏洞或误编程的风险,攻击者可以利用这些漏洞来操控合约,从而实现攻击,窃取资产。
4. **技术过时**:加密技术持续演进,而用户可能在无意中使用了过时的加密算法。这可能导致安全性下降,给攻击者可乘之机。
因此,用户需要定期更新安全策略,合理管理私钥,并选择安全的存储方式以降低风险。
如何保护你的加密资产?

为了确保加密货币的安全,用户可以采取以下几种措施:
1. **冷钱包与热钱包结合使用**:冷钱包是指不与互联网连接的设备,如硬件钱包和纸钱包,优先存储长期投资;热钱包则是在线钱包,适合日常交易。用户可以根据需求进行选择。
2. **使用强密码和双重认证**:保护加密货币账户和钱包时,使用复杂、不易被猜测的密码至关重要。与此同时,启用双重认证可增加额外的安全层,减少被攻击的风险。
3. **定期更新软件**:无论是钱包软件还是交易平台,定期更新可以帮助用户修复已知的漏洞,确保系统的安全性和兼容性。
4. **学习防范教育**:用户需要了解常见的网络攻击手法,增强自身的安全意识,避免在弱点上受困,相应提升对加密资产的保护能力。
可能相关的问题
1. 加密货币的私钥如何安全保存?
私钥是加密货币安全的核心,因此其存储安全至关重要。用户可以选择多种方式保护私钥,比如:
1. **冷存储**:通过将私钥存储在完全离线的设备,例如硬件钱包,来降低被黑客攻击的风险。这种方式非常安全,因为黑客即便想要获取私钥,也无法通过互联网接触到冷钱包。
2. **纸钱包**:将私钥打印成纸质文件,确保存放在物理安全的地方。然而,纸钱包也有其风险,如火灾、洪水等自然灾害可能导致遗失。用户需对此提前评估。
3. **加密存储**:使用加密软件加密私钥,然后将加密文件存储在云服务或安全地方。这种方式确保私钥仍是安全的,即使存储设备被盗,黑客也无法获取私钥信息。
4. **多重备份**:用户可以考虑将私钥在不同地点进行多重备份,增强防丢失的能力。但是,应确保这些备份同样采用安全措施以防泄露。
2. 智能合约如何影响解锁机制?
智能合约是区块链技术的重要组成部分,它不仅可以增强解锁机制的灵活性和安全性,还引入了一些新的挑战。与传统的解锁机制相比,智能合约具有自动化、透明和不可篡改的特性,但同时也可能存在安全漏洞。
智能合约的自动执行机制意味着用户可以设定各种条件来解锁资金,比如时间限制、交易数量、或者特定条件的满足。这种灵活性可以帮助用户充分利用资源,也更好地实现资产管理。
然而,智能合约在设计和实现过程中也可能出现问题。一旦部署,不能轻易修改,若合约逻辑存在缺陷,就可能导致用户的资产被绑定或窃取。因此,在使用智能合约时,安全审计和测试是必不可少的步骤。
用户需确保他们所使用的智能合约经过严格审核,并选择信誉良好的平台进行交易。随着技术的发展,生态系统中的合约安全性将逐渐增强,但用户仍需保持警惕,避免过度信任。
3. 解锁机制的漏洞如何被利用?
解锁机制的漏洞可以被恶意攻击者利用来获取用户的资产,这一过程通常涉及到对系统的深入了解。黑客可能采用各种手段,包括社交工程、网络钓鱼、恶意软件等,来黑进用户的账户。
比如黑客可以通过伪装成技术支持团队发出邮件,并诱骗用户提供其私钥或其他敏感信息。此外,许多用户并不知道如何保护自己的私钥或多重认证,黑客可能通过这些缺陷进行攻击。
在区块链智能合约中,合约的开发者可能会忽视代码中的错误或漏洞。例如,一个过期的合约或无效的条件逻辑可能会被利用,使得提取资产成为可能。攻击者可以利用这些隐患,从中获利,因此,在选择合约时,用户也必须具备相关的知识。
4. 未来的解锁机制会如何发展?
随着加密技术的不断演进,解锁机制也将迎来新的发展方向。未来可以期待以下几个方面的变化:
1. **生物识别技术的应用**:由于传统密码、私钥易受攻击,未来会越来越多地采用生物识别技术,如指纹识别、面部识别等。利用生物特征进行身份验证,可以增强解锁过程的安全性。
2. **区块链身份体系的建立**:一些项目正在尝试创建去中心化身份体系,用户的身份信息可以在区块链上进行验证,而无需依赖中心化的身份认证机构。这样的体系能够加强用户在各种服务中的身份安全性。
3. **AI技术的运用**:人工智能技术可以帮助识别和防范潜在的可疑活动,提高解锁机制的主动防护能力。例如,通过机器学习模型分析用户的交易行为,实现对异常行为的实时审查。
4. **更加动态的智能合约**:未来智能合约可能会变得更加复杂和智能,具备应对突发情况的能力。这意味着,当市场条件改变时,智能合约的执行也能在不同场景中进行适应和调整。
总之,加密货币解锁机制不仅关乎个人资产的安全,也决定了整个区块链生态系统的稳定性。用户应时刻关注最新的技术动态和安全知识,从而更好地保护自己的数字资产。
总结来看,加密货币的解锁机制是连接用户与其数字资产之间的桥梁,其安全性与灵活性直接影响到用户的财富安全。在未来的发展中,随着技术的演进,解锁机制也将不断,为用户提供更加安全、便捷的资产管理体验。